Trace propagation looks mostly right, but you're dropping the parent span when requests hop from Larkspur-API into the Fennel queue worker. New folks: every service in the Ostberry mesh must forward the trace header unchanged, or the Mirth dashboard shows orphaned spans. Also, sampling is configured per-service, not globally — don't hardcode it. The sampler, buffer, and flush settings come from a shared config, reproduced here.

tuning table, yajog-yahof:
BUDGETS = {
    "lamvan": 303,
    "wenox": 460,
    "fenvan": 525,
}

## Formula sandbox tuning

User-supplied formulas in Gridmoor execute inside a restricted interpreter with hard ceilings on time, memory, and call depth. Reviewers should confirm any change to these ceilings is justified in the PR description, since raising them widens the abuse surface. Defaults were chosen from production traces. The current limits are as follows.

limits module of tafog-fawip:
WEIGHTS = {
    "julix": 57,
    "lamys": 992,
    "kasvan": 209,
    "quenok": 750,
    "alddor": 259,
    "oliath": 1009,
    "wenix": 815,
}

## Runbook: Ardentia consent banner rollout

The banner rolls out in three waves by region, gated behind the `consent-ui` flag. Each wave requires sign-off that consent records are written to the audit store before any non-essential cookie is set; the enforcement proxy drops violating requests and logs them for review. Rollback is flag-only and takes effect within five minutes — no data migration is involved. Audit log retention matches the standard 13-month policy. The enforcement proxy in each wave runs with these configuration values.

deployment values, bagug-yagep:
zorwyn:
  log_level: error
  metrics_host: metrics.zorwyn.zemvarlabs.internal
  pool_size: 8